traffic-shaping adaptation percentage

Use traffic-shaping adaptation percentage to set the rate adjustment percentage for FRTS
adaptation.
Use undo traffic-shaping adaptation percentage to restore the default.
Syntax
traffic-shaping adaptation percentage number
undo traffic-shaping adaptation percentage
Default
The rate adjustment percentage for FRTS adaptation is 25%.
Views
FR class view
Predefined user roles
network-admin
Parameters
number: Specifies the rate adjustment percentage, in the range of 1 to 30.
Usage guidelines
When rate adjustment is triggered, the router reduces or increases the traffic rate by the set
percentage of the current rate. The adjusted rate must be between the CIR and the CIR ALLOW. For
example, the current rate is 3000 bps, the rate adjustment percentage is 20%, and the CIR is 2500
bps. The rate is reduced to 2400 bps (3000 – 3000 x 20%). Because the adjusted rate cannot be
lower than the CIR, the adjusted rate should be 2500 bps.
Examples
# Set the rate adjustment percentage to 20%.
<Sysname> system-view
[Sysname] fr class test1
[Sysname-fr-class-test1] traffic-shaping adaptation 20
Related commands
fr traffic-shaping
